Topic:  CALM:  The Key to Healthy Relationships

Speaker:  Susan Holt

Description: Does your brain get “hijacked” by anxiety, frustration or anger with other people in your relationships at work or home?  Do you need more bandwidth these days? What is the key to building relationships that are authentic and true to who YOU are?  Susan will share her simple but super-effective acronym CALM. She will teach the concept behind each letter and then guide you into a quick role-play to try it out for yourself!

Speaker Bio:  Susan Townsend Holt is a Board-Certified Family Life Coach and Director of Everyday Parenting Solutions in Richmond. She serves on the board of the Family Life Coaching Association.  Susan has a Master’s degree in education, 22 years teaching as a Reading Specialist for adults and children, and 8 years of family life coaching.  She is thrilled to teach social/emotional learning and relationship-building to families and educators through workshops and individual appointments.  You can find out more about Susan at SusanHoltCoaching.com and catch up on her parenting advice in  Richmond Family Magazine  on her website on the “Articles” page.
